Essential Supplies and Creative Bingo Card Ideas

Essential Supplies and Creative Bingo Card Ideas

Gathering the right supplies is crucial to making your bingo night a memorable and seamless experience. Consider investing in quality bingo cards, colorful markers, and a loud, clear call bell to keep the energy buzzing. Don’t forget a comfortable space with enough seating and good lighting to ensure everyone can see their cards without strain. Snacks and drinks add a delightful touch-think finger foods and beverages that guests can enjoy without interrupting the flow of the game. For those looking to keep scores, small notepads or score sheets are a handy addition.

To elevate the fun, try creating your own bingo cards with imaginative themes or personalized prompts. Instead of classic numbers, fill cards with quirky challenges like “sing a line of your favorite song” or “tell a fun fact about yourself.” You can mix standard game patterns with creative variants such as “X marks the spot” or “Four corners and center”. Here’s a quick creative layout suggestion:

Pattern Description Fun Twist
Classic Line Complete a horizontal, vertical, or diagonal line. Use song titles instead of numbers
Four Corners Mark all four corners on the card. Include personal trivia on corner squares
Blackout Cover the entire card. Bonus prizes for creative shout-outs
  • DIY Card Kits: Print blank templates for guests to customize.
  • Marker Alternatives: Use themed tokens like mini candy or coins.
  • Calling Variants: Add riddles or clues instead of straightforward calls.

Tips for Smooth Game Flow and Memorable Moments

Tips for Smooth Game Flow and Memorable Moments

To keep the excitement high and avoid any downtime, plan a few quick mini-games as buffer activities between the bingo rounds. These could include simple challenges like “guess the number” or “bingo fact trivia.” Maintain an upbeat tempo by using a lively playlist to fill any gaps and by having a co-host to help call numbers and engage players. Additionally, preparing prizes in advance and displaying them prominently not only adds a visual incentive but also keeps participants eager to play.

Fostering memorable moments means personalizing the experience. Incorporate themed bingo cards or play rounds with fun twists, such as “reverse bingo” or “pattern bingo.” You can also encourage players to share quick stories or fun facts when they win a round-this creates laughter and bonding among the group. Don’t underestimate the charm of a playful photo booth corner with props for winners to capture their victorious smiles!

  • Use vibrant, themed bingo cards to enhance engagement
  • Keep rounds short to maintain energy
  • Prepare backup prizes for surprise rounds
  • Encourage social interaction with light-hearted banter
Round Type Description Suggested Prize
Classic Bingo Standard play with traditional patterns Gift card
Pattern Round Win by matching shapes like letters or symbols Novelty item
Speed Round Quick-fire numbers called rapidly Snack basket
